POSITION SCOPE:

The Housing Maintenance Lead plays a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of housing facilities within the Atikameksheng Anishnawbek community. This position involves overseeing daily maintenance activities, coordinating maintenance activities, and ensuring that all housing units are safe, functional, and well-maintained. Key responsibilities include conducting routine inspections, and coordinating and performing repairs and preventive maintenance tasks. The Housing Maintenance Lead also develops and coordinates maintenance schedules, responds to emergency maintenance requests, and addresses maintenance concerns from residents. Additionally, they assist in budget management, maintain accurate records, adjust maintenance plans based on seasonal demands, and engage with the community to provide updates on repair status. Demonstrating a commitment to serving the Atikameksheng Anishnawbek community is essential in this role.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S:

  • High school diploma or Equivalent
  • Technical training, such as building maintenance, carpentry, plumbing, electrical, or HVAC systems, is highly preferred
  • Diploma in Facilities Management, Mechanical techniques, Construction Management, or a related field is considered an asset.
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ience in housing maintenance or a related field

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Attend conferences, training, and meetings to remain current with information on housing maintenance programs and techniques.
  • Communicate effectively with community members to address maintenance concerns and provide updates on repair status.
  • Develop and manage maintenance schedules, prioritize work orders, and coordinate with contractors and vendors as needed.
  • Address maintenance concerns from residents, providing timely solutions and communicating effectively to enhance satisfaction.
  • Prepare monthly program and statistical reports
  • Monitor program expenditures and maintain tracking tool
